The NIHR Norfolk Clinical Research Facility has two full-time vacancies for a Senior Laboratory and Data Support Officer covering multiple specialties including stroke, neurology, diabetes, endocrine, gynaecology, paediatrics, and orthopaedics.

As the successful post holder, you will work collaboratively within the Research Team, offering comprehensive laboratory and data support for various clinical research studies, including genomics. In addition to laboratory and data responsibilities, you may undertake a range of clinical duties and will demonstrate a commitment to promoting, integrating and embedding research across the Trust.

Our goal is to improve the treatment and care of patients here at NNUH and beyond. The ideal candidate will be dedicated to this goal; as well as our Trust's PRIDE values. Regulation in research is high; therefore, you should have an understanding of trial protocols and policies, as well as an awareness of research governance issues.

Main duties of the job

Overseeing the recording, monitoring, maintenance and reporting of research-related data to uphold standards of data quality and accuracy. Compliance with ICH-Good Clinical Practice (GCP), EU clinical trial regulations, Standard Operating Procedures (SOP's), and Trust policies will be paramount. Conduct daily clinical trial activities, such as participant recruitment, sample and data collection in line with your competencies and experience, whilst adhering to study protocols and regulatory requirements. Assist with logistical issues for the set-up and running of the study to ensure the wellbeing and safety of participants and staff, in accordance with research regulation. Provide administrative support to the research team for all research trials on the research team portfolio, from trial feasibility to archiving. Process data relating to individual research studies including data input, resolving data queries, verifying source data and accuracy. In conjunction with the Research Nurse (RN)/ Clinical Research Practitioner (CRP)/ Registered Midwife (RM), identify suitable participants eligible for the study/clinical trial; screen and recruit research participants using detailed knowledge of the protocols as appropriate. Take and process clinical trial samples, following appropriate training, ( venepuncture, centrifuge training) as per protocol and specific laboratory requirements.
